We started doing exercises designed to strengthen my posture and my core.  Everyone talks about core but I really did not understand why it is so important.  Liane explained that the core muscles of the body are the deep muscles of the back, abdomen, and pelvic floor. These are the muscles we rely on to support a strong, supple back, good posture, and efficient movement patterns. When the core is strong, the frame of the body is supported.

Pilates also involves concentrating on your breathing.  I found that I was mostly breathing through my mouth and only taking shallow breathes (no wonder I sound sexy on the phone – which I have to say does lead to disappointment when you meet me!!). By doing Pilates I was learning to breath through my nose.  I also found that after an hour of Pilates I felt less stressed.

One of the benefits of Pilates, is that you do not have to be extremely fit to try it out.  It is a  workout regime for all ages. Liane explained to me that building core strength, focusing on proper alignment, and a body/mind integrative approach make Pilates accessible to all. With thousands of possible exercises and modifications, Pilates workouts can be tailored to individual needs.
